Recognised by 30 years of awards and accolades, Cyrus consistently pushes the boundaries of audio technology and works tirelessly towards the ultimate hi-fi system to reproduce the sound and feeling of a live performance without any interference or loss of detail.

Cyrus’ decision to design, manufacture and support their projects in the UK can seem quite unusual today, but customers who call for higher quality products, appreciate their superior standards and Cyrus are unable to match these standards overseas.